What is a microgrid cost model?

The National Renewable Energy Laboratory was commissioned by the U.S. Department of Energy to complete a microgrid cost study and develop a microgrid cost model. The goal of this study is to elucidate the variables that have the highest impact on costs as well as potential areas for cost reduction. This study consists of two phases.

How do you finance a microgrid project?

Reference 8 also discusses project financing in terms of microgrid business models, finding that third party financing (i.e., private debt financing) of a microgrid project which pays itself back with energy savings and resilience is the most straightforward approach.

What makes a good microgrid project?

Simply put, from an investment perspective, a microgrid project must be well understood, come from standard design practices, and deliver worthwhile financial returns. The literature on microgrid design has recognized this.

Are microgrids a good investment?

Microgrids that incorporate renewable energy resources can have environmental benefits in terms of reduced greenhouse gas emissions and air pollutants. In some cases, microgrids can sell power back to the grid during normal operations. Depending on the complexity, microgrids can have high upfront capital costs.

Do microgrid design models provide sufficient return on investment (ROI)?

Investors need to see that a project provides sufficient return on investment (ROI) to offer funding. However, microgrid design models optimize around the cost of technology purchases to provide potential returns, where solutions are wholly dependent on input assumptions.
